    Trust me... after I discovered standard $40.00 aftermarket off the shelf 45* and 90* elbows would not work when replacing exhaust components on my truck... ...and had to pay $300.00 each.. I know.. and that one was not chrome.. ..the elbows between the frame rails that my stacks sit in were over $400 apiece chrome plated.. and it was lousy chrome that had chips and rust in it after only a year... The cool thing is a manager at TruckPro told me a few months ago they will soon be offering special exhaust components, truck model specific, so it appears drastic price cuts are in Paccars future on these if they are to remain competitive...
